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Philippine Gray Flying Fox | Pino Blanco |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Animalia (Animals) | Plantae (Plants)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Coniferophyta (Conifers)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Pinopsida (Conifers) |
| Order | Chiroptera (Bats) | Pinales (Pines & Allies) |
| Family | Pteropodidae (Fruit Bats) | Podocarpaceae |
| Genus | Pteropus (Flying Foxes) | Podocarpus |
| Species | Pteropus speciosus | Podocarpus parlatorei |
